
The Good
The 2018 Volvo V60 offers a blend of performance and practicality. Its turbocharged engines provide adequate power. Known for its comfortable seats and refined ride, appealing to comfort-focused buyers. The wagon body style provides ample cargo space, making it practical. Its Scandinavian design and focus on safety can emotionally attract buyers.
The Bad
Potential weaknesses of the 2018 Volvo V60 include its infotainment system, which some find less intuitive than competitors. Repair costs can be higher than average due to Volvo's premium brand status. While generally reliable, some owners have reported issues with electronic components. Ensure all scheduled maintenance has been performed.
2018 Volvo V60: Quick Overview
- Engine Options:
- T5: 2.0-liter turbocharged inline-4
- T6: 2.0-liter turbocharged and supercharged inline-4
- Polestar: 2.0-liter turbocharged and supercharged inline-4 (tuned for higher output)
- Horsepower:
- T5: Around 240 hp
- T6: Around 302 hp
- Polestar: Around 362-367 hp
- Fuel Economy (estimated):
- T5: 25 mpg city / 36 mpg highway
- T6: 22 mpg city / 31 mpg highway
- Polestar: 20 mpg city / 27 mpg highway
- 0-60 Times (estimated):
- T5: 6.4 seconds
- T6: 5.6 seconds
- Polestar: 4.5-4.8 seconds
- Towing Capacity:
- Around 3,300 lbs (may vary based on configuration)
- Trim-Level Features:
- T5 Dynamic: Standard features include leatherette upholstery, power driver's seat, panoramic sunroof, and Volvo's Sensus infotainment system with a 7-inch display.
- T5 Inscription: Adds leather upholstery, wood trim, and upgraded interior features.
- T6 R-Design: Sportier styling, sport seats, and a sport-tuned suspension.
- T6 Inscription: Combines the luxury of the Inscription trim with the more powerful T6 engine.
- Polestar: High-performance engine, upgraded brakes, Γhlins suspension, and unique styling elements.

What Technology & Safety Features are Included?
Standard driver-assistance features include City Safety (automatic emergency braking), lane departure warning, and a rearview camera. Optional features include adaptive cruise control, blind-spot monitoring, rear cross-traffic alert, and park assist.
Safety is a Volvo hallmark. The 2018 V60 generally receives good crash-test ratings from the IIHS (Insurance Institute for Highway Safety) and NHTSA, although specific ratings may vary depending on the model year and trim level. Standard safety features include multiple airbags, anti-lock brakes, and electronic stability control. Volvo's focus on safety contributes significantly to the V60's appeal. Optional features like pedestrian and cyclist detection further enhance safety. The Sensus system, while offering many features, can be less intuitive than systems from competitors.
